Which among the following is the unit of resistivity?
1. ohm-metre
2. ohm-metre2
3. ohm per metre
4. per ohm per metre

Correct Answer - Option 1 : ohm-metre

The correct answer is option 1) i.e. ohm-metre

CONCEPT:

  • Resistance: The hindrance to the flow of current offered by a material is called electrical resistance.
    • The SI unit of electrical resistance is the ohm (Ω).
    • The resistance of a conducting wire is given by the equation:

\(R = ρ\frac{l}{A}\)

Where R is the resistance, l is the length of the wire and A is the cross-sectional area of the material.

EXPLANATION:

Electrical resistivity, \(ρ = R\frac{l}{A}\)

  • The SI unit of resistance (R) is Ω, length (l) is m, and that of cross-sectional area (A) is m2.

\(\Rightarrow ρ = \Omega (\frac{m}{m^2}) = \Omega m\)

  • Thus, the unit of resistivity is ohm-meter.
